Think about the last time something didn’t go the way you hoped it would. Maybe it was a tough diagnosis you expected to be healed, or a big test you thought you would pass, or a friendship you anticipated to reconcile. It can be discouraging when we hope for good things that don’t go the way we want. Honestly, it can even lead us to get angry with God.
In moments like that, it’s important to remember that there is so much joy in knowing God is our one and only strength. God is the only one able to sustain us! So, when everything around you seems shaky, when you’re sad, or when things aren’t going like you hoped, don’t let your anger keep you from God. Instead, know that God always has and always will provide everything you need.
Today, go for a walk. Think of all the ways God has sustained you and strengthened you, even in the middle of hardship. Spend some time praising God for who God is and what God has done!

About this Plan

Raising the bar for a conversation on grief. A high school devotional designed to help students navigate seasons of grief in their lives. In this devotional, you’ll find encouragement to turn to Jesus for support, love, and comfort as you grieve.
